I just got my trail np (not xl) and also Leapers 3-12x44 scope. I have ran over 100 JSB match pellets and some crosman wadcutters through this and I can't seem to get the scope to go up high enough. I have put the centerpoint scope that came with the rifle and managed to get that zero'd in pretty close. What am I doing wrong with the Leapers?

If you haven't already...try this

Look the scope rings  over...Is the rear scope ring riding a little higher?  Put a mark on  your rings, differentiating  the front from the rear and remove from the scope and switch them (front to rear etc.).  Also, while the rings are off of the rifle look at the base is there a burr or something that is causing the rings not to ride level?
